East Street Arts is looking for an artist to take up residency within one of its innovative artist pods at 34 Boar Lane in Leeds.

The new immersive art pop-up at the former Arkwright’s Tool Emporium, was developed in collaboration with LJ Real Estate and is a making, showing and social space for artists and those living in and visiting Leeds.  

The space is made up of an open, stripped back area with five freestanding artist pods. These act as rooms that can be moved around within 34 Boar Lane. The artist pods were created by Studio Bark, an architecture practice with an ethos rooted in sustainable DIY design.

Each pod is 2.7m x 2.4m, and from July to September, East Street Arts is looking for an artist to take up residence in one. The space will be provided in kind for this period.


The opportunity:

We are looking for an artist who will regularly use the space; not necessarily solely as a studio. We’re open to all suggestions and ideas and there are no specific criteria for the available pod. Although they do lend themselves to a ‘cleaner’ practice, the arts charity is happy to discuss this, so if you’ve got an idea, please don’t hold back!

In your application, please indicate how much time on average per week you plan on using the space.

In exchange for the space, which will be provided in kind, the successful artist will have an active role in looking after the space and be a key part of the 34 Boar Lane community. During the residency, there may also be opportunities to use this fantastic city centre based, street-level project space, as well as the potential for public facing activity too.
